Californian dies scuba diving on Great Barrier Reef

Powered by CDNN - CYBER DIVER News Network
by LUTHER MONROE - CDNN Safety News Editor

CAIRNS, Australia (20 Feb 2006) -- A tourist from California died while scuba diving on the Great Barrier Reef.

The victim was a 64-year-old male who encountered problems at depth while scuba diving at Saxon Reef near Cairns.

The diver had no pulse and was not breathing when he was pulled from the water.

Attempts to revive the diver with CPR failed and he was pronounced dead at the scene.

 

The victim was transported to Cairns by helicopter.
